Output ab5b61ebe084c1fc018b10a140bf2a0e6c29f5f0b496e1f23f627f34d07a2010:25

value
239561
script pubkey
OP_0 OP_PUSHBYTES_20 3ebb13b40a95d45db2b686fe90cfe25fdcc52e97
address
bc1q86a38dq2jh29mv4ksmlfpnlztlwv2t5hk0895g
transaction
ab5b61ebe084c1fc018b10a140bf2a0e6c29f5f0b496e1f23f627f34d07a2010
spent
true